Abstract
PURPOSE:To produce decorative black color metal having gloss from any metallic materials by compressing ultrafine powder of metals and their alloy under heating and finishing the surfaces thereof. CONSTITUTION:When gaseous Ar of about 100Torr is sealed into a vacuum deposition device, and Cu is heated to evaporate by using filaments of W, Cu atoms evaporate and at this same instant, they collide against the residual gaseous molecules of low temp., grow to bigger sizes and stick to the inside wall of the device, thereby forming fine powder. The average grain sizes of this fine powder is within a 0.1-0.01mu range. Next, this fine powder is recovered, and is molded under pressurizing at about 350 deg.C by using a vacuum hot press, then, the molding is machined, ground and finished to accuracy of about 0.5-1mu surface roughness, whereby it is made into the product of a black color tone. Metals and alloys having the characteristics required depending upon use objects are selected for the ultrafine powder. It is equally well to use plasma jet flames as a method of producing the ultrafine powder.
